A look at Marc Jacobs’s many faces

His outfit at last night’s Met Ball kind of seals it. Marc Jacobs just might be the Madonna of the fashion design world when it comes to reinvention. We look back at his transformation from shy, pale, spectacled hipster to hard-bodied, Mediterranean-looking hotness in a lace dress.
The early years: Long-haired and slightly rumpled like the cool TA from your undergrad days



Hip and lean: Retro tees replace the button-downs and sweaters. The shirts are just tight enough to reveal a hint of a six-pack underneath.


The Caeser chapter: Contact lens! Who knew his eyes were so dreamy? The blue-dyed Caesar haircut highlights the green and amber flecks of his peepers just so.

The skirt stage: With the jawline of a Greek god and rock hard legs, Marc wows us with his body — in a skirt.



That dress: Because those legs mustn’t go to waste, a streamlined dress seems like a natural progression from the kilt. The pilgrim shoes take the look to a new level of boldness. Is this the same shy guy from 2005? It’s hard to believe, but yes. Lady Gaga should take notes.
